Letter from Frank Harper to Bernard E. Sunny

Frank Harper tells Bernard E. Sunny that it is impossible for Theodore Roosevelt to speak to both the school children and the Daughters of the American Revolution separately, so if the planned event cannot combine both groups, then one must be abandoned. Privately, Harper shares that Roosevelt would prefer to speak to the school children, although he hopes some way can be found to combine the two.
